I have been one of your readers of Yemen Times for a long period. I have also written letters to Yemenis abroad regarding tribalism in Yemen. It has to be stopped”once and for all” so that Yemen can prosper as any other developing country. Otherwise it will still lag behind as it has in the past, and as it does now. I really liked your “View Point” on Yemen’s Main & Everlasting Problem: Lack of Law Enforcement. Yemen will lose a lot of tourism and foreign investors if tribalism continues with its western cowboy style; carrying guns and ammunition and kidnapping anyone they see on the road. The Yemen Government should strictly ban the carrying of weapons, otherwise this will create a bigger problem for the government in future. Statistics show that there are around 45 million weapons in a population of 17.5 million i.e. approximately three weapons per person in Yemen. Please keep teaching our fellow Yemenis through Yemen Times about the enforcement of the law banning the carrying of weapons. KEEP UP THE GOOD WORK AND ALLAH WILL HELP YOU.
